Description
This notice amends the notice of a major disaster declaration for the State of Michigan (FEMA-4880-DR), dated July 22, 2025, and related determinations. The amendment includes assistance for utilities among those areas determined to have been adversely affected by the event declared a major disaster by the President. The affected counties include Alcona, Alpena, Antrim, Charlevoix, Cheboygan, Crawford, Emmet, Kalkaska, Mackinac, Montmorency, Oscoda, Otsego, and Presque Isle, as well as the Little Traverse Bay Bands of Odawa Indians. Assistance is provided under the Public Assistance program for emergency work and permanent work in specified categories.
